Output d6124d7f697a1a197371aec6b56e00fe678b3b53308a88eb161a55e6d957529b:0

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97006c58ae5c36dcb7f2c094e40551ab5a190a4c OP_EQUAL
address
3FTSTv7YfqZRpVXBHTfzPrYXzw8upQJ9pq
transaction
d6124d7f697a1a197371aec6b56e00fe678b3b53308a88eb161a55e6d957529b
spent
true